It’s Time: Kaka Should Leave Real Madrid

I personally think that it’s a good idea if Kaka departs to another club. Don’t get me wrong, I do like him at Real Madrid (he gets great support from Madridistas and maintains a reputable image for the club) but my issue is that he barely gets any playing time. When I think of Kaka at Madrid, I just picture wasted talent on the bench. This is the same player that had made the starting for almost all of his matches in his Milan days. Kaka now, in the present? He rarely makes it into the starting XI and is even lucky to get some, if any, playing time. It deeply saddens me to see his career has come down to this.

As a Madrid supporter and a Kaka admirer (who doesn’t love this guy?), it pains me to know that someone with great skills and abilities is not able to bounce back because his club won’t give him sufficient opportunities. I am one of those firm believers that feels Kaka is capable of reaching the same potential that he used to live up to. This is why I think that Kaka leaving Real Madrid would be best for his career.

Now I’m not blaming Real Madrid (ok maybe I am a little) but it’s a complicated situation. Part of the blame has to go to them, right? Not giving Kaka enough responsibility and importance on the pitch has got to be a factor that contributes to his poor form.

On the other hand, I can understand where Real Madrid is coming from. They paid a lot of money for him and have high expectations. From the club’s perspective, I do understand that getting a player back into form can be something hard to do, especially at a club like Real Madrid. With top players like Mesut Ozil and Luca Modric competing for the same position as Kaka, getting play time does not come easy. There are high demands in terms of performance.

Real Madrid had paid about 65 million Euros for the Brazilian and won’t sell him off willy-nilly. That is where the problem lies. Real Madrid doesn’t want to sell Kaka because they do not want to lose money. If Kaka stays at the Santiago Bernabéu, it will become harder to return back to form.

Kaka is one of those special individuals that you cannot describe in words (as a person and as a player). Using them would not be adequate enough to express his incomparable qualities.
